The Divine Perspective on Time

Many philosophical traditions suggest that time, as we experience it, is a limited construct. From a divine viewpoint, existence isn't a linear sequence, but more of a simultaneous "now." This doesn’t mean that read more events don't happen; rather, they’re all occurring within a broader framework that transcends our ordinary comprehension. The concept of past and coming loses much of its relevance when considered from this transcendent plane, fostering a sense of serenity and interconnectedness with all life.

God Remains Beyond All Boundaries Regarding Chronology

Many philosophies explore the concept of the Divine as a being residing outside the sequential flow of time . This understanding suggests that It is not bound by the former days, the now , or the impending events, but rather observes them all together. This notion challenges our earthly perception of reality and directs to a more profound recognition of a transcendent force. Some readings even claim that experiencing the Divine involves a shift beyond our temporal limitations, allowing for a glimpse into eternity .
